Definition


"The position" refers to a specific job role within an organization that comes with defined duties, responsibilities, and sometimes a rank or level. It indicates where someone fits in the company structure and what tasks they are expected to perform.

Etymology


The phrase "the position" derives from the Latin word 'positio,' meaning 'a placing' or 'arrangement.' Over time, it evolved in English to signify a particular place or status, especially within an organizational or social context.
